- Description
- NASA/HQ plans to issue a Request for Offer(RFO)to complete a scholarly book-length manuscript on the history of NASA's Planetary Protection Efforts. The NASA History Office will administer this project and manage professional review and oversight of the final publication of the work. The book should focus on the time period since NASA?s inception in 1958 with some background discussion of antecedent thoughts and efforts. The NASA History Division will administer this project jointly with the Office of Space Science. The goal of this research project is to produce a roughly 400-page manuscript history of the views of scientists, engineers, policymakers, enthusiasts, and the general public regarding planetary protection. While focusing on NASA, this manuscript should also examine efforts by other countries and international organizations. The finished manuscript is to be delivered within three years and must reflect extensive research of NASA records, scientific journals, and the records of other relevant government agencies (for example, the Smithsonian Institution, the Department of Defense, personal paper collections, and private company archives). The contractor should use oral history interviews as appropriate to augment written records as source material for this book. The contractor should transcribe the most significant oral histories and deliver them to the NASA History Office to make part of its Historical Reference Collection. All of the research materials, including interview tapes and transcripts, collected during the project will be archived with the NASA History Division, forming a coherent collection other researchers can use for future histories. Work Location: Work shall be performed at the contractor facility and at NASA Headquarters and relevant Field Centers such as the Ames Research Center, Jet Propulsion Laboratory, Johnson Space Center, and Langley Research Center. The contractor shall carry out the project using contractor office space, equipment, and supplies; however, workspace and photocopying will be made available to the investigator when researching in NASA facilities.
